## Step 2: Migrate undo/redo history settings

Plotfern 4.0 replaces the in-memory undo stack with a persisted history log. Customers upgrading from 3.x will lose any unsaved undo state — warn them to finish open edits first.

After upgrade, the editor rebuilds history from the new log. Default depth rises from 50 to 200 steps; redo branches are now retained. If a customer reports missing redo entries, check the history settings before escalating.

The relevant defaults shipped in 4.0 are these.

service settings:
[silwyn]
host = silwyn.crelvogrid.internal
user = silwyn_svc
database = silwyn_prod

Security reviewer: confirm that both custodians are present and that the hardware token for the Garrowfield parking-garage occupancy feed has been freshly initialized. Verify the tamper seal number against the ceremony log, then witness the custodians splitting the signing key into two shares. Record the timestamp and have all parties initial the margin. Before sealing the envelope, the lead custodian must read aloud and transcribe the recovery passphrase, which appears below.

unlock words, yawig-kagef: gordor-holvan-ulaael-pramir-ulaiel-tamdor

Subject: Ownership change — sort stability in Ledgerloom report builder

Hello plugin authors,

As of next release, responsibility for the Ledgerloom sort-stability guarantees is moving to a new maintainer. The stable-sort contract your plugins rely on — equal keys preserve insertion order — remains unchanged, and any future modification will be announced two releases in advance with a migration guide. Please direct compatibility questions, bug reports, and edge-case clarifications regarding sorting behavior to the new owner named below.

approver of faduf-bagug = Framir Sorwyn